Deadbolt Installation
New deadbolt installation in Austintown homes costs $160-$320 depending on door material and whether we need to reinforce the frame. Many post-war homes here were built with only a knob lock - no deadbolt at all. Others have a single-cylinder deadbolt installed poorly, with a strike plate held by half-inch screws that won’t stop a forced entry. We install properly: a reinforced strike with 3-inch screws into the framing, correct backset measurement, and clean mortising. For homes near Lake Erie’s weather influence, we recommend weather-sealed cylinders that resist the freeze-thaw seizing that hits Austintown every winter.

Lock Rekey
Rekeying in Austintown costs $25-$45 per lock cylinder, plus a service call. It’s the most cost-effective way to secure a home when the hardware itself is sound. We rekey Schlage, Kwikset, and most older keyways still found in Austintown’s aging stock. Rekeying makes old keys useless while keeping your existing locks - ideal for new homeowners, inherited properties, or landlords between tenants. In the rental corridors near Mahoning Avenue, we rekey entire properties to master key systems so owners carry one key, tenants another, and maintenance a third. Done right, and backed in writing.

Common Residential Locksmith Problems We See in Austintown Homes
- Frozen deadbolts from freeze-thaw cycles. The Mahoning Valley’s sharp winter temperature swings, with periodic lake-effect influence from Lake Erie, drive moisture into exterior lock cylinders. Older Schlage and Kwikset sets with worn weather seals seize solid by January. We see the spike start every November and run through March.
- Swollen wooden door frames binding latches. Winter moisture absorption causes original 1960s and 70s door frames to expand and rack. The deadbolt won’t throw. The latch won’t catch. Sometimes the fix is frame adjustment, sometimes it’s a properly installed replacement with correct tolerances.
- Failed spring mechanisms in original knob sets. Forty to sixty years of use, and the return spring inside a 1970s cylindrical knob set finally snaps. The knob spins freely. The latch doesn’t retract. The door won’t open from either side without destructive entry. We carry replacements that fit the same door prep without modification.
- Three generations of mismatched hardware on rental properties. In the pockets near Mahoning Avenue, we regularly open doors with a 1970s knob set, a 1990s deadbolt, and a newer chain - none keyed alike, none installed by the same person, none maintained. The property has never had a unified key system. We fix that.

Replace them. Original knob sets from the 1960s and 70s use springs and internal components that are past their service life. Repair is rarely cost-effective because parts are discontinued and the next failure is months away, not years. A modern cylindrical set installed on the existing door prep costs $140-$280 and gives you keyed-alike convenience with current security standards. Moisture absorption in wooden door frames causes seasonal swelling, especially in Austintown’s older homes with original softwood framing. The door racks slightly in the jamb, and the deadbolt no longer aligns with the strike plate. Sometimes planing the frame or adjusting the strike solves it. Other times the root issue is a settling foundation or repeated moisture intrusion that requires more extensive correction. We diagnose the actual cause rather than forcing hardware that will fail again in six months. Call for a flat-quote inspection.
